  • Abstract
    Fiber optical transmission systems are potential competitors with conventional wire, coaxial cable and waveguide facilities in virtually all sectors of the communication network. They are attractive because glass fiber optical waveguides are relatively inexpensive, have miniature cross section, are strong and flexible and can transmit broadband signals with low distortion. This presentation will review the technology of fiber optical communications systems, citing the characteristics of fiber optical waveguides and their influence on system performance, device requirements, and transmitter and receiver systems design.
